Slow Cooker Sloppy Joes

Slow Cooker Sloppy Joes combine ground beef or a beef-turkey mix with fire-roasted diced tomatoes, chopped onions, celery, and garlic in a rich sauce made with chili sauce, ketchup, brown sugar, and an array of spices. Cooking slowly on low heat deepens the flavors, resulting in a hearty, savory filling. The texture is moist and chunky, making it ideal for scooping onto soft buns or even thick potato chips for a casual meal.

Description

The Slow Cooker Sloppy Joes recipe uses a blend of ground meats and aromatic vegetables cooked slowly to blend savory, sweet, and tangy flavors. The fire-roasted tomatoes add a subtle smoky depth, while brown sugar and ketchup balance acidity with sweetness. Spices like cumin, chili powder, and paprika provide warmth without overwhelming heat. Cooking in a slow cooker allows the flavors to meld and the beef to become tender and juicy.

The finished sloppy joes offer a thick, saucy texture that holds well on sandwich buns or can be enjoyed without bread using sturdy potato chips as scoops. This approach makes for an adaptable meal suitable for casual gatherings or quick family dinners.

Serving suggestions include soft buns of various sizes and a variety of pickles such as dill spears, sweet refrigerator pickles, or pickled red onions to add acidity and crunch. Ripple potato chips provide a contrasting texture and a hands-on experience. The recipe’s step of browning meat and onions prior to slow cooking helps reduce excess fat and develop richer flavor.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 3 pounds ground beef I also do a combination of ground beef and turkey, usually 2 lbs. beef & 1 lb. turkey, lean
  • 1 yellow onion finely chopped, large
  • cups celery finely chopped
  • 6 garlic minced, large cloves
  • 1 can 14.5 ounces fire roasted diced tomatoes
  • 1 cup chili sauce
  • ½ cup ketchup
  • cup brown sugar packed
  • 2 tablespoons prepared mustard
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• ½ tablespoon mustard powder dry
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der medium
  • 1 tablespo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• ½ teaspoon paprika
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per or more to taste, freshly ground
  • salt to taste, additional

Instructions

  1. In a skillet over medium-high heat, brown ground beef and onion together until beef is cooked, breaking up beef with a spatula. Drain off fat and transfer to a slow cooker. Or just use a multi-cooker - brown the beef and onion right in the cooker, and drain off fat.
  2. Add all remaining ingredients to slow cooker and stir well. Cover and cook on low for 4 to 6 hours. The longer cook time will give a deeper flavor.

Notes

  • Use soft buns or dinner rolls to hold the juicy filling without falling apart.
  • Include pickles like dill spears, sweet pickles, or pickled red onions for acidity and texture contrast.
  • Ripple potato chips are a sturdy alternative for serving the sloppy joe mixture without bread.
  • Browning the meat and onions before slow cooking reduces fat and intensifies flavor.
